Unplugging for a Better Break: KitKat's Rawdogging Revolution

In a bold move, KitKat is urging Australians to embrace the 'rawdogging' trend, a phenomenon that has taken the internet by storm. But what exactly is rawdogging, and why is a chocolate brand encouraging it?

The Rawdogging Revolution

Rawdogging, simply put, is the act of going phone-free during your daily commute or any long journey. It's a digital detox on the go, and it's gained massive traction, with over 45 million TikTok posts dedicated to this trend. KitKat, known for its break-time treats, is now challenging commuters to join the rawdogging revolution with its 'Rawdog your Commute' Challenge.

A Game-Changing Challenge

The challenge is simple: play the 'Phone Break' game and see how long you can go without touching your phone. It's a fun way to encourage a much-needed break from our digital devices. The longer you go, the better your chances of winning a relaxing weekend getaway, courtesy of KitKat. This initiative is a breath of fresh air, especially considering that 84% of Australians crave a break from their phones, according to KitKat's research.

The Benefits of Going Phone-Free

What's fascinating is the impact of going phone-free, even accidentally. KitKat's research reveals that 40% of those who've experienced a phone-free period felt happier, freer, and more present. It's a reminder of the importance of taking a break and the positive impact it can have on our well-being. As Shannon Wright, Nestlé Oceania's head of marketing confectionery, puts it, "KitKat has always been about helping Aussies take better breaks, but in today's world, switching off isn't so easy."
